F1778410M2DBB0 Equivalent & Substitute Parts

Part Overview

The F1778410M2DBB0 is a 0.1 µF film capacitor manufactured by Vishay Beyschlag/Draloric/BC Components, designed for EMI and RFI suppression applications. This radial polypropylene metallized capacitor operates at 630V DC and maintains performance across -55°C to 110°C. The part is currently active in production with 713 units in stock. Substitute parts are identified when electrical specifications, mechanical dimensions, and compliance certifications match the original component, enabling direct replacement in circuit designs without performance degradation.

Key Parameters

Parameter Value
Capacitance 0.1 µF
Tolerance ±20%
Voltage Rating - DC 630V
Voltage Rating - AC 310V
Dielectric Material Polypropylene (PP), Metallized
Operating Temperature Range -55°C to 110°C
Mounting Type Through Hole
Package / Case Radial
Size / Dimension 0.492" L x 0.236" W (12.50mm x 6.00mm)
Height - Seated (Max) 0.472" (12.00mm)
Lead Spacing 0.394" (10.00mm)
Termination PC Pins
Ratings X2
RoHS Status ROHS3 Compliant

Q: Are there differences in series designation between these parts?

A: The F1778410M2DBB0 belongs to the F1778X2 series, while BFC233820104 and BFC233824104 belong to the MKP338 2 series. Despite different series designations, all three parts meet identical electrical and mechanical specifications for this application.

Q: Do all three parts have the same moisture sensitivity level?

A: No. The F1778410M2DBB0 lists MSL as Not Applicable, while BFC233820104 and BFC233824104 specify MSL 1 (Unlimited). This difference does not affect substitution compatibility for standard through-hole radial capacitor applications.

Q: What is the lead spacing requirement for PCB layout?

A: All three parts require 10.00mm (0.394") lead spacing for through-hole mounting. PCB footprints designed for the F1778410M2DBB0 are compatible with BFC233820104 and BFC233824104 without modification.
